Job Description

We are seeking an experienced, client focused, professional, and entrepreneurial Associate Director, Project Management to join our proactive Canberra project leader's team. Working across current greenfield and brownfield development projects in infrastructure development including education and childcare, you will join the Colliers team to benefit from exposure to all manner of clients and sectors. You are joining a business that focuses on working together, provides excellent client service and harvests new opportunities. 

The Senior Project Manager is responsible for: 

  • The operational delivery of projects in line with client and contractual requirements;  
  • Leadership, management and mentoring of project personnel to ensure superior team performance in all aspects of project delivery including development approvals, scope management, time management, cost management and profitability, procurement human resources, communications and project governance, risk management, contract administration, health, safety, quality assurance and environment. 
  • Chairing and leading all aspects of projects. 
  • Ensuring project outcomes and objectives set by the National Director are met. 
  • Manage and promote the business development and marketing of potential projects including proposal preparation, contract negotiation with prospective clients and award of new projects. 
  • Proven ability in managing the delivery of projects that satisfy the clients expectations, financial results, program and procedures. 
  • Ensuring Developed systems and procedures are fully implemented to ensure that the business is not at risk of non-compliance with third party accreditations 
  • Risk and Opportunities are tracked on the project to ensure the Client is aware of the key issues on the project regularly. 
  • Ensure all internal and external reporting is maintained. 
  • Assisting the Associate Director/ Directors / National Directors in the development and maintenance of superior client and key stakeholder relationships. 

Qualifications

  • Minimum 5 - 8 years' experience 
  • Ideally University degree qualified, in Project Management, Engineering, Architecture, Planning, Design or Construction. Qualifications in formal project methodologies is desirable. 
  • End to end project oversight and delivery - including project planning, budget management, risk management, issue management, personnel management, client management, commercial issue management, testing management. An understanding of the real estate / property industry is desirable. 
  • Large scale contract administration experience and skills required. 
  • Excellent communication skills both written and oral, ability to converse with all levels of staff from senior level management to technical staff. 
  • Knowledge and understanding of procurement and rules and experience in delivery of Government (Federal or State) Projects. 
  • The capability to lead, inspire and motivate others to action, through setting a clear direction and harnessing the full capability of the team to deliver. 
  • It is essential to be highly proficient in Microsoft Office suite of products (PowerPoint, Word, Excel) and Microsoft Project. 
  • Development Management, Business Case and Development Approvals experience also desirable.
